South Kashmir Sports Festival-2021 concludes at Batpora Stadium Shopian
FacebookTwitterWhatsapp

Srinagar: The fortnight-long South Kashmir Sports Festival-2021 concluded today at Batpora Stadium Shopian, after a spectacular sports extravaganza involving various disciplines, including Cricket, Volley Ball, Kabbadi and Athletics, said a defence spokesperson.

“The Inter-District Sporting event had commenced on 17 August 2021 and was organised by Indian Army, as part of Swamim Vijay Varsh celebrations. The event saw the best of South Kashmir compete in various disciplines to earn a place in the finals here today at Batpora Stadium, Shopian,” the spokesperson said.

The spokesperson further said: “The pulsating final events in Athletics, Volley Ball and Kabbadi enthralled the large crowd of over 5000 people with some captivating moments of skill, grit and undeniable passion.” “The winners in various events are as follows; Pulwama Gymkhana won the Cricketing event, Kulgam were adjudged the winners in Kabaddi & Volleyball, Younish Shakeel of Kulgam won the gold medal in 100m dash, while Asif Dar from Pulwama won the gold in 200m and Team Pulwama won the gold in 4x100m relay,” the spokesperson said.

“To commemorate the Sporting event, a grand 110 feet National Flag was hoisted. A daring display of the indigenous Kashmiri Martial Arts “Sqay” was also given by the Shopian District Sqay team. Foot tapping music added to the sporting fervor,” he said.

“Lieutenant General DP Pandey, General Officer Commanding Chinar Corps attended the Concluding Ceremony. He was joined by Maj Gen Rashim Bali, GOC Victor Force, Vijay Kumar, IGP Kashmir, Deepak Ratan, IG (Ops) CRPF Kashmir and several other civil and military officials,” the spokesperson said.

“Speaking to the athletes, GOC Chinar Corps applauded the efforts of all sportspersons and encouraged them to give their best in future sporting events. He highlighted the importance of sports in all round development of youth. He also pointed out the abundance of natural sporting talent in Kashmir and exhorted them to actively pursue their interests in sports,” he added.
